Filing 6 OBJECTION to #5 Report and Recommendations by Jay Williams. (Attachments: #1 Envelope)(gsm) |
Filing 5 REPORT AND RECOMMENDATIONS of the United States Magistrate Judge re #1 Notice of Removal filed by Jay Williams. Having not received the filing fee or an application to proceed IFP by the court-ordered deadline, the court RECOMMENDS that this action be DISMISSED without prejudice for failure to comply with a court order and failure to prosecute. Signed by Magistrate Judge John D. Love on 1/12/2023. (gsm) |
Filing 4 ACKNOWLEDGMENT OF RECEIPT by Jay Williams as to #3 Order. Received 12/8/2022. (ndc) |
Filing 3 ORDER of Deficiency re #1 Notice of Removal filed by Jay Williams. ORDERED that Plaintiff has thirty (30) days from the receipt of this order to either pay the $402 filing fee or submit an application to proceed in forma pauperis. The Clerk shall accept no other documents from Plaintiff until he has complied with this order. Signed by Magistrate Judge John D. Love on 11/30/2022. (gsm) |
Filing 2 CASE REFERRED to Magistrate Judge John D. Love (jbe, ) |
Filing 1 NOTICE OF REMOVAL by Jay Williams from Henderson County Family Court - CC2, case number FAM 21-0772. (Filing fee $ 402), filed by Jay Williams. (Attachments: #1 Exhibit A, #2 Exhibits, #3 Memorandum)(jbe, ) |
